May 14--
Long Road early. Perfect weather. Cowbirds and Goldfinch. Goldies stepped on the stems of dandelions to make them bend their heads to the ground so the birds could eat the seeds. Clever little things.
Lunchtime at Mill Road. Pair of nesting Mute Swans. Yellow Warbler pair going crazy...must have a nest.
Hummingbird at home.

May 15--
Cool, cloudy, breezy.
Long Road early a.m. -- saw Orioles and RW Blackbirds building nests. Barn and Rough-winged Swallows swooping over pond and fighting.
